Resposnibilities:
- Processes documents arriving in the area through the Documentation System.
- Attaches and reviews document properties.
- Approves documents and properties in the documentation system and releases them for distribution.
- Circulates change control packages for review and approval, monitors approvers' responses, and ensures necessary approvals are obtained.
- Completes work according to established priorities, policies, practices, and procedures to ensure documentation is sent according to schedule.
- Verifies the impact of procedural changes on different operational systems such as SAP, LIMS, MES/POMS, Delta V.
- Verifies synchronization of changes between operational systems and documentation.
- Coordinates changes among shared documents for Worcester, ABL, and Singapore plants.
- Trains employees in system techniques.
- Receives, evaluates, and assigns document effectiveness dates.
- Communicates procedure and CR status to initiators and negotiates implementation timelines if necessary.
- Conducts proofreading of documents received in the documentation area.
- Verifies and receives documents.
- Notifies affected areas and the Training department of generated changes.
- Executes changes in SAP and DSP operational systems.
- Troubleshoots conflicts in the Documentation system or operational systems.
- Prepares/Reviews manual PCRs for use in the SVP (Small Volume Parenteral) and BDS (Bulk Drug Substance) areas.
- Manages the retention room and coordinates document transfer to Iron Mountain.
- Provides assistance to operations according to Environmental, Health, and Safety (EH&S) management systems and promotes continuous improvement.
- Associate's degree in Secretarial Sciences, Business Administration, or Natural Sciences, with three (3) years of experience.
- High School diploma or GED with five (5) years of experience in document control.
- Strong knowledge in Word, excel and AttachePro.
- Bilingual (English/Spanish)
